On knowing this, Shri Ram sent a peace envoy to Ravan and<br />
requested to return Sita <strong>Ji</strong>. But Ravan did not agree. Preparations<br />
for the battle were done. Then the problem arose that how should<br />
the army cross the ocean?<br />
Shri Ramchandra, standing in knee-deep water for three days,<br />
with folded hands requested the ocean to give way. But the ocean<br />
did not move a slightest bit. The ocean did not listen to him. Then<br />
Shri Ram tried to burn it with a fire arrow (Agni baan). Frightened<br />
ocean appeared in the form of a Brahmin 1 and said, “Bhagwan (lord),<br />
everyone has its own limitations. Do not burn me. Who knows how<br />
many living creatures live in me. Even if you will burn me, you will<br />
not be able to cross me because a very deep crater will be formed<br />
here which you can never cross.”<br />
The ocean said, “Lord, do something so that snake also dies<br />
and stick also does not break. My bounds are maintained and your<br />
bridge is also formed.” Then Shri Ram asked the ocean that what is<br />
that way? The ocean in Brahmin-form said that there are two soldiers<br />
named Nal and Neel in your army. They have such a power from<br />
their Gurudev 2 that even stones stay afloat from their hands.<br />
Everything, be it iron, floats. Shri Ramchandra called Nal and Neel,<br />
and asked them if they had any such power. Nal and Neel replied,<br />
“Yes, even stones will not drown from our hands.” Shri Ram said,<br />
“Demonstrate it.”<br />
Those fools (Nal and Neel) thought that today they will earn a<br />
lot of praise in front of everyone. That day they did not remember<br />
their Gurudev Shri Muninder (God Kabir) <strong>Ji</strong> thinking this that if we<br />
will remember him then Shri Ram might think that we do not have<br />
any power and we have asked for it from somewhere else. They<br />
took a stone and dropped it in water and it drowned. Nal and Neel<br />
tried a lot but the stones did not float. At that time, Shri Ram looked<br />
at the ocean as if was trying to say that you were lying. They do not<br />
have any power. The ocean said, “Nal-Neel, you did not remember<br />
your Gurudev today. Fools, remember your Gurudev.” They both<br />
